1. **Yogurt**
Yogurt is often hailed as a probiotic powerhouse, a natural source of beneficial bacteria that can enhance gut health. The live cultures found in yogurt, such as Lactobacillus and Bifidobacterium, help balance the gut microbiome, support digestion, and prevent issues like bloating and constipation. When choosing yogurt, look for varieties labeled “live and active cultures” to ensure you’re getting a high concentration of probiotics. To further improve its effects, consider adding a sprinkle of fiber-rich fruits like berries or bananas.

2. **Whole Grains**
Whole grains are an excellent source of dietary fiber, which is crucial for promoting healthy digestion. Fiber aids in regulating bowel movements, preventing constipation, and it can also help in maintaining a healthy weight. Foods like brown rice, quinoa, whole grain bread, and oats not only provide essential nutrients but also promote a healthy gut by feeding the beneficial bacteria living in our intestines. Incorporating whole grains into your meals can lead to more significant digestive health benefits over time.

3. **Leafy Greens**
Leafy greens like spinach, kale, and collard greens are nutrient-dense foods that play a significant role in digestive health. They are high in fiber which helps to keep the digestive system running smoothly. Additionally, these greens are rich in v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ants that support overall health. Leafy greens contain chlorophyll, which can help increase the production of enzymes needed for digestion. Making salads a regular part of your meals or adding greens to smoothies is an easy way to include them in your daily diet.

4. **Ginger**
Ginger is a versatile spice that has been used for centuries for its medicinal properties, particularly for digestive health. It has anti-inflammatory and antioxidant effects, which can soothe the digestive tract and reduce nausea. Ginger can be consumed in various forms, such as fresh, powdered, or as tea. It stimulates saliva, bile, and gastric enzymes, which assist in the digestion process. Including ginger in your meals, whether as a seasoning for vegetables or as an addition to smoothies, can significantly enhance your digestive well-being.

5. **Bananas**
Bananas are a convenient and nutritious snack that also supports digestive health. They are rich in fiber, particularly pectin, which can help regulate bowel movements and improve gut health. Bananas are also a source of prebiotics, which feed the beneficial bacteria in your gut. Furthermore, they can help calm an upset stomach and prevent diarrhea. Enjoying bananas raw, in smoothies, or even baked into healthy treats can ensure you reap their digestive benefits.
